Lab Geometry Processing (MA-INF 2226, 9CP)

This lab course will offer projects related to recent topics in (3D) geometry processing. For most this will mean implementing an existing baseline or algorithm and then improving one aspect of it. At the end of the semester a presentation about the project has to given (in a block event).

Requirements

  • There are no formal course requirements.
  • All projects will be implemented in Python and prior experience is highly recommended. There will be no introduction to Python and the projects will be hard to complete while learning the language.
  • Prior experience with 3D geometric data is beneficial but not necessary.
